McDonald/Manella/Zohar: How and When to Break the Rules in Chess Chessbase Der Leser ist aufgefordertMaster Strategic Principles and Know When to Defy Conventional Wisdom How and When to Break the Rules in Chess by Neil McDonald, Noam Manella, and Zeev Zohar teaches players to recognise when established opening theory can be bent or abandoned for tactical advantage.
